Anita, in violation of a specific agreement not to extend credit over $1,000 without the other partners' approval, extends credit of $2,000 to a friend. Anita will be held personally liable to the partners for any unpaid debt since she violated the duty of obedience.
Sherman Act
A foundational antitrust law in the United States aimed at prohibiting monopolistic practices and promoting competition.
Antitrust Legislation
Laws implemented to prevent anti-competitive practices, monopolies, and to promote fair competition in the marketplace.
Triple Damages
A legal term referring to a form of punitive damages awarded by a court, where the amount of actual damages is tripled as a penalty or deterrent to the defendant.
